How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Lawrenceville?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Lawrenceville Studio Apartments | $970 | $425 | $1,600 |
| Lawrenceville 1 Bedroom Apartments | $927 | $528 | $1,850 |
| Lawrenceville 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,265 | $610 | $4,449 |
| Lawrenceville 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,496 | $706 | $2,000 |
| Lawrenceville 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,456 | $804 | $1,849 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Lawrenceville
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Lawrenceville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Lawrenceville ranges from $528 to $1,850 with an average monthly rent of $927.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Lawrenceville c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Lawrenceville range from $610 to $4,449.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,265.
How expensive are Lawrenceville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 19 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Lawrenceville on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$706 to $2,000 - averaging $1,496 for the location.
